Stunning Comeback Lifts Cal Over Ducks
Bears Erase Early Five-Goal Deficit For Victory
BERKELEY – The California lacrosse team dug itself an early hole before storming back with a breathtaking turnaround, defeating Oregon 10-7 yesterday afternoon at California Memorial Stadium.
It looked as though the Ducks (4-1) would have their way with the Golden Bears at the outset, leading 6-1 at the end of the first period and limiting Cal's scoring chances. But the Bears scored the next seven goals in a row over a span of 22:30 to surge in front 8-6 midway through the third inning. When Oregon finally broke its scoring drought with 3:42 remaining in the third to trim Cal's advantage to a single goal, it had been over 26 minutes since the Ducks found the back of the net.
Sophomore Emily Moes led the scoring with three goals while Courtney Wong, Kennedy Mason, and Jane Middleton each added a pair of scores apiece. Goalie Chloe Rand made 13 saves for the Bears.
After the teams traded a goal each to begin the game – with Mason getting on the scoreboard first for Cal – the Bears were dominated for most of the remainder of the first quarter. But Cal turned up the defense and clawed back, with Mason and Middleton each scoring twice during the decisive run. Middleton gave the Bears the lead with back-to- back goals after the game was tied at 6-6.
The Ducks' Liv Kozitza scored her third goal to cut Cal's lead to 8-7 with 3:42 left in the third quarter, but Moes closed it out with back-to-back goals.
The Bears return to ACC play Friday by hosting Duke at California Memorial Stadium.

It's a Hockey Night in the Music City! 🎶🎶
The Pittsburgh Penguins (14-14-5, 4th in the Metropolitan) take a visit to Bridgestone Arena tonight in the first game of their roadtrip before the holiday break to play the Nashville Predators (9-17-6, 7th in the Central)
The Penguins are coming off of a thrilling comeback OT win at home against the LA Kings, a team that had been riding the high of a 5-1 blowout against the New York Rangers at MSG on Saturday.
Conversely, the Nashville Predators are also fresh off of a win against the Rangers, which saw goaltender Juuse Saros collect his third shut out of the season.
This is the first of two meet-ups for the teams this season, with the final one coming in early February.
Some Notes and Facts
The Predators are 10-6-3 at home against the Penguins in the regular season.
The last time these two teams met was back in April, when the Penguins had gotten a second wind in an attempt to push themselves into the playoffs while the Predators were a sure lock in the Central. Nashville would go on to play the Canucks in the first round of the Western Conference playoffs and lose in 6 games.
In the meeting back in April, Crosby had scored a power play goal seven minutes into the game, which set the tone for the Penguins. Karlsson, Reilly Smith and Emil Bemstrom had also made the goal scoring sheet that night as the Penguins were led to a 4-2 win.
Predators' captain Roman Josi has not played since Dec. 10 after sustaining a lower body injury in a game against the Dallas Stars. Even though the 34 year old Swiss defenseman participated in morning skate today, he was ruled out of tonight's game.
On the other side, the Penguins are coming into this game without defenseman Marcus Pettersson who also sustained a lower body injury in a game against the Senators. To make up for the loss, last night the Penguins made a move that brought back former blue liner P.O Joseph, who had been a free agent that went to the St. Louis Blues. Joseph traveled to Nashville but is not playing in tonight's game.
Goaltending Matchup
PGH- Coach Mike Sullivan confirmed this morning that Tristan Jarry will be starting in net for the Penguins tonight. Jarry is 3-0-2 and has a 1.97 GAA and a .928 SV% against the Preds.
NSH- While coach Andrew Brunette hasn't announced a goalie for tonight yet, it would be safe to say that Justus Annunen will be between the pipes, based on Saros' performance Tuesday night. Annunen is 7-5-0 overall this season with a .890 SV% and 2.91 GAA.
The 24 year old Fin was recently acquired from Colorado at the end of November. He has played 2 games for the Preds, with a 1-1-0 record.
Leading Scorers
PGH points and assists leader is Sidney Crosby (31P, 23A, 8G)
Rickard Rakell leads the Penguins in goals, with 14 total and 3 coming on the power play. Fun fact from the Pens PR department : "Since Team Sweden left him (Rakell) off the Four Nations roster, Rakell leads all Swedish-born players with four goals and eight points in six games." Pretty incredible turnaround for Rakell who had a less than stellar 2023-2024 season that was hampered with an upper-body injury that had him sidelined for 12 games in November.
NSH points and assists leader is Roman Josi (23P, 16A, 7G). Unfortunately, Josi will be unavailable for the game tonight.
Filip Forsberg leads the Preds in goals with 9 total and 3 PPG as well. Forsberg is coming off his best season with the Predators last year where he scored 94P (48G, 46A, 13PPG, 19PPA).

CFO Guidance for Nike's Turnaround

Nike held its Q1 2025 earnings call on Tuesday, notably without the presence of either its outgoing CEO, John Donahoe, or incoming CEO, Elliott Hill. However, the company’s CFO, Matthew Friend, stepped in to explain Nike’s challenging quarter and outline plans to prevent further decline amid its leadership transition.
For the three-month period ending on August 31, Nike’s revenue dropped 10% year over year to $11.6 billion. Sales from Nike Direct fell by 13%, digital revenue declined by 20%, and wholesale revenue dipped 8%. However, Nike’s brick-and-mortar stores showed a 1% increase.
Friend, who has been with Nike for over 15 years and has served as CFO since 2020, emphasized that the company is moving “aggressively” to realign its product portfolio, create a better balance in operations, and regain brand momentum through sports. He acknowledged that a comeback of this scale takes time, stating, “While there are some early wins, we have yet to turn the corner.”
Following Nike’s withdrawal of its full-year projection and indefinite postponement of their investor day during Tuesday’s results call, the company’s stock dropped almost 5% on Wednesday morning, according to Fortune.
Turnaround Challenges
Four years after his retirement, Elliott Hill is set to return to Nike on October 14 as the president and CEO, the company announced on September 19. Hill, who worked at Nike for 32 years, held various leadership roles, including president of its consumer and marketplace business units and overseeing commercial and marketing operations for both Nike and the Jordan brand.
However, both Hill and CFO Matthew Friend face several challenges in their efforts to turn the company around.
